Output 52e892a953be63f63d71d4ec1387b80694b2d7ad7d8a0feb6517bfc090860428:1

value
6437468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d11bfa34ad4698a8b61d62e4db589a83b58ae91 OP_EQUALVERIFY OP_CHECKSIG
address
16ZuUtujuNZuUXgAmH6XdboUEYi997shBY
transaction
52e892a953be63f63d71d4ec1387b80694b2d7ad7d8a0feb6517bfc090860428
spent
true